Birmingham 2022 Commonwealth Games day one finals live blog

It’s the first finals session of the Birmingham 2022 Commonwealth Games with Team England’s swimmers in the hunt for seven potential medals.

There’s also nine swimmers taking part in semi-finals in this evening’s session so there’s plenty up for grabs over the next three hours of swimming.

This evening’s action sees 14 Team England swimmers in action in the Men’s 400m Freestyle Final, Women’s 400m Individual Medley Final, Women’s 200m Freestyle Final, Women’s 100m Freestyle S9 Final, Men’s 50m Butterfly Semi-Finals, Women’s 50m Breastroke Semi-Finals, Men’s 100m Backstroke Semi-Finals, Women’s 100m Butterfly Semi-Finals and the Men’s 200m Breastroke Final.

Team England’s will also take part in the Mixed 4x100m Freestyle Relay Final in the last event of the session.

The action from the Sandwell Aquatics Centre gets underway at 7pm.
